ECONOMIC INTERPENETRATION / (eu) banking

Hans Dalborg, managing director of the Finnish-Swedish group MERITANORDBANKEN has declared that the bid for the Norwegian bank CHRISTIANA BANK, in which it already has a 9.9% stake, would stand despite its rejection by the State shareholder (one third of the capital). This bid, valuing CHRISTIANA at EUR 3 bn, runs until 31 January. See EI of 17 December.
